Uplifting Lessons Learned from Raising a Son with Trisomy 21
Exploring the emotional journey of a parent facing the challenges of raising a child with Down syndrome, the narrative unfolds in three parts: the personal story, the lessons learned from Alex, and Alex's own perspective. The author emphasizes love's power over fear and the unique gifts each person possesses. This heartfelt account serves as both a tribute and a guide, reinforcing a commitment to positivity and resilience in the face of adversity, ultimately revealing profound insights into the human experience.
